Given two events A and B of a sample set :-
P[A] = 0.20
P[not B]=0.40
![P[B/A]=0.25](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=P%5BB%2FA%5D%3D0.25)
To find P[A or B]:
......[1]
Calculate for
and ![P[A \cap B]](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=P%5BA%20%5Ccap%20B%5D)
P[B] = 1- P[not B]
Substitute the value P[not B] we get;
P[B] = 1-0.40 = 0.60
![P[A \cap B] = P[B/A] \cdot P[A]](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=P%5BA%20%5Ccap%20B%5D%20%3D%20P%5BB%2FA%5D%20%5Ccdot%20P%5BA%5D)
Substitute the given values we get;
![P[A \cap B] = 0.25 \cdot 0.20 = 0.05](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=P%5BA%20%5Ccap%20B%5D%20%3D%200.25%20%5Ccdot%200.20%20%3D%200.05)
Then;
Therefore, the value of P[A or B] is, 0.75.
